Backdoor Pilot Explained

A backdoor pilot is a feature-length episode or two-part story within an existing series that is designed to introduce characters and settings for a possible future spinoff. If the test episode performs well with audiences and meets network expectations, it can lead to a traditional pilot and series order. For Blue Bloods, this approach allows CBS to evaluate fan interest and financial risk before committing to a full launch.

How CBS Decisions Shape a Release Date

Network planning cycles heavily influence when a Blue Bloods spinoff could move from development to series order. CBS schedules are shaped by contract renewals, talent availability, and promotion strategies for existing hits. If a backdoor pilot earns strong ratings and positive internal reviews, executives may greenlight a traditional pilot, which then competes against other projects for slot allocation. Streaming platform partnerships and advertising market conditions can also shift priorities, extending timelines or accelerating them.

What a Backdoor Pilot Means for Timing

Because a backdoor pilot blurs the line between episode and pilot, it can complicate scheduling. Filming may occur months before airdate, and post-production, approvals, and marketing add further lead time. Even after a pilot is completed, network legal, finance, and marketing teams review performance before committing to a series. As a result, measured progress indicators are more reliable signals than informal reports of casting or script activity.

Indicators of Genuine Progress

When evaluating claims about a Blue Bloods spinoff release date, prioritize official signals over speculation. A network press release, a showrunner comment at a sanctioned event, or a casting database listing with a studio tag are stronger evidence than social posts or unverified industry rumors. Track these milestones in order to contextualize any future announcement.

  • Official pilot order or series greenlight from CBS
  • Publicized director and showrunner attachments
  • Main cast offers and contract signings
  • Filming start dates or completed episode deliveries
  • Network premiere calendar placement
